SOC 499 - Honors Work in Sociology
Independent work for honors students in which students apply sociological theory and methods to a major research project and paper that is then presented orally before an examining committee. Honors work is typically completed in two 3 credit hour semesters. This course serves as an alternative to the SOC 490 capstone requirement for sociology general track majors.
